A lot of times they aren't really dead, just very close. You should gather them all up and keep them next to your bare skin while warming towels in the dryer or figuring out another way to keep them warm. Some people submerse them in warm water, or use a blow dryer on a warm setting. Hopefully you may still be able to bring them back!
